summaryrefslogtreecommitdiff
path: root/src/core/main.c
diff options
context:
space:
mode:
authorLennart Poettering <lennart@poettering.net>2016-02-03 21:10:56 +0100
committerLennart Poettering <lennart@poettering.net>2016-02-03 21:10:56 +0100
commit37723f806ea80a5d1b257507f1a14db888ea93c0 (patch)
treed715eb32de523724c06521c08b1b35ba9303a033 /src/core/main.c
parenta92ff4003f693c0f6a8bb8be844b9c1692add71b (diff)
parentd723cd6554f0b4457d079d3be3ec07b2b5b011a9 (diff)
Merge pull request #2522 from 0xAX/check-early-mount
manager: print fatal error if early mount failed
Diffstat (limited to 'src/core/main.c')
-rw-r--r--src/core/main.c6
1 files changed, 5 insertions, 1 deletions
diff --git a/src/core/main.c b/src/core/main.c
index 84e292afd2..99ef723fcb 100644
--- a/src/core/main.c
+++ b/src/core/main.c
@@ -1369,7 +1369,11 @@ int main(int argc, char *argv[]) {
initrd_timestamp = userspace_timestamp;
if (!skip_setup) {
- mount_setup_early();
+ r = mount_setup_early();
+ if (r < 0) {
+ error_message = "Failed to early mount API filesystems";
+ goto finish;
+ }
dual_timestamp_get(&security_start_timestamp);
if (mac_selinux_setup(&loaded_policy) < 0) {
error_message = "Failed to load SELinux policy";